Brief Title Kidney Volume in Live Donors Kidney Transplant Donors and Recipients
Official Title Measurement of Kidney Volume Using Computed Tomography in Kidney Transplant Donors and Recipients
Brief Summary The investigators aim to investigate the association between renal volume measured through pre-donation CT auto-segmentation and postoperative renal function of both donors and recipients. After establishing the statistical significance of the association, the investigators intend to create and validate predictive models for renal function at surgery, 1 year, and 3 years postoperatively, incorporating various factors known to contribute to renal function deterioration.
